We were not, but it is pretty confusing. Apollo used his Alert Viper Pilot ability on the Chief's Crisis Card. Here's how it went:
1. Chief has his turn.
2. His Crisis Card is Heavy Assault, adding ships to the board.
3. Apollo uses his Alert Viper Pilot ability to commandeer the viper that was set up in Sector 6. AVP gives him a bonus action. He used it to scout the Crisis Deck and bury it.
4. The rest of the Crisis Card resolves (the basestars fired on Galactica, and missed).
5. Chief's turn ends and Apollo's turn begins.
It gets confusing because we had to rewind a bit to give Apollo the chance to use his AVP; but that's how it works out in the right order.
